When I took over a gym, I wanted to level it up. I battled it with my most powerful Pokemon (who was about twice the CP of the pokemon in the gym) and I gave less prestige when I used a more powerful Pokemon (+100) than when I used one closer to the CP of the gym'd Pokemon (+284).

So, how is prestige gain computed? Prestige loss is fairly static but it's unclear to me what the rate of gain is and what influences it.
